Popularity Through the Ages

Popularity trends for names are kind of like fashion—they come and go. Evelyn first hit the charts in the late 19th century in the U.S., peaking in the early 1920s. Then, like many vintage gems, it took a little break, only to make a triumphant return in recent years. Today, it ranks among the top 20 girl names, according to the Social Security Administration.

And here’s a fun fact: Evelyn isn’t just popular in the States. It’s also trending in the UK, Australia, and Canada. Why? Maybe because it’s that rare name that feels both classic and fresh. Or maybe it’s just got good vibes. Either way, people love it.

Famous People Named Evelyn

Biography of Notable Evelyns

Let’s talk about some real-life Evelyns who’ve made waves. First up, Evelyn Underhill, a renowned British writer and mystic whose works on spirituality are still studied today. Then there’s Evelyn Boyd Granville, one of the first African American women to earn a Ph.D. in mathematics. Talk about breaking barriers!

And let’s not forget Evelyn Keyes, the Hollywood actress known for her roles in films like “Gone with the Wind.” Or Evelyn Glennie, the world-famous percussionist who happens to be deaf. These women prove that Evelyn isn’t just a name—it’s a statement.
